Output 0929f8264a4c71e0a71c6fced50cd148741624427d75c0b1e3518a204a5f434a:8

value
137622489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d96b3da79059d0b2d6c90327486dbedf5620d05 OP_EQUAL
address
MRBcUga23QtciazyMnEg8D5Rxmd39EkZXZ
transaction
0929f8264a4c71e0a71c6fced50cd148741624427d75c0b1e3518a204a5f434a
spent
true